Nearly £8 million is given to Leicester for new transport schemes
Leicester’s £7.84 million grant is the result of the city council’s successful bid for a share of £60 million of DfT funding for schemes in 2019/20.

Cities and regions across the UK are bidding for a share of £1.2 billion of DfT funding for schemes that support the local economy and improve air quality.
The funding is part of the £1.7 billion Transforming Cities Fund and could be used for a number of purposes, not limited to the improvement of bus, cycle and tram routes.
